/packages/inputmethods/LatinIME/tests/src/com/android/inputmethod/compat/ |
D | LocaleSpanCompatUtilsTests.java | 26 import android.text.Spanned; 53 private static void assertLocaleSpan(final Spanned spanned, final int index, in assertLocaleSpan() 63 private static void assertSpanEquals(final Object expectedSpan, final Spanned spanned, in assertSpanEquals() 69 private static void assertSpanCount(final int expectedCount, final Spanned spanned) { in assertSpanCount() 85 assertLocaleSpan(text, 0, 1, 5, Locale.JAPANESE, Spanned.SPAN_EXCLUSIVE_EXCLUSIVE); in testUpdateLocaleSpan() 92 text.setSpan(styleSpan, 0, 7, Spanned.SPAN_EXCLUSIVE_EXCLUSIVE); in testUpdateLocaleSpan() 96 assertLocaleSpan(text, 1, 1, 5, Locale.JAPANESE, Spanned.SPAN_EXCLUSIVE_EXCLUSIVE); in testUpdateLocaleSpan() 103 Spanned.SPAN_EXCLUSIVE_EXCLUSIVE); in testUpdateLocaleSpan() 106 assertLocaleSpan(text, 0, 1, 5, Locale.JAPANESE, Spanned.SPAN_EXCLUSIVE_EXCLUSIVE); in testUpdateLocaleSpan() 113 Spanned.SPAN_EXCLUSIVE_EXCLUSIVE); in testUpdateLocaleSpan() [all …]
|
D | SuggestionSpanUtilsTest.java | 25 import android.text.Spanned; 70 if (!(actualText instanceof Spanned)) { in assertNotSuggestionSpan() 73 final Spanned spanned = (Spanned)actualText; in assertNotSuggestionSpan() 84 assertTrue(actualText instanceof Spanned); in assertSuggestionSpan() 85 final Spanned spanned = (Spanned)actualText; in assertSuggestionSpan() 120 Spanned.SPAN_COMPOSING | Spanned.SPAN_EXCLUSIVE_EXCLUSIVE /* requiredSpanFlags */, in testGetTextWithAutoCorrectionIndicatorUnderline() 136 Spanned.SPAN_COMPOSING | Spanned.SPAN_EXCLUSIVE_EXCLUSIVE /* requiredSpanFlags */, in testGetTextWithAutoCorrectionIndicatorUnderlineRootLocale() 220 Spanned.SPAN_EXCLUSIVE_EXCLUSIVE /* requiredSpanFlags */, in testGetTextWithSuggestionSpan() 230 Spanned.SPAN_EXCLUSIVE_EXCLUSIVE /* requiredSpanFlags */, in testGetTextWithSuggestionSpan()
|
D | TextInfoCompatUtilsTests.java | 24 import android.text.Spanned; 49 final private static int TEST_STYLE_SPAN_FLAGS = Spanned.SPAN_EXCLUSIVE_INCLUSIVE; 53 final private static int TEST_URL_SPAN_FLAGS = Spanned.SPAN_EXCLUSIVE_EXCLUSIVE; 66 final Spanned expectedSpanned = (Spanned) text.subSequence(TEST_CHAR_SEQUENCE_START, in testGetCharSequence() 76 assertTrue("should be Spanned", actualCharSequence instanceof Spanned); in testGetCharSequence()
|
/packages/inputmethods/LatinIME/tests/src/com/android/inputmethod/latin/utils/ |
D | SpannableStringUtilsTests.java | 25 import android.text.Spanned; 54 new String[] {"" + i}, Spanned.SPAN_PARAGRAPH), in testConcatWithSuggestionSpansOnly() 55 i * 12, i * 12 + 12, Spanned.SPAN_PARAGRAPH); in testConcatWithSuggestionSpansOnly() 64 final Spanned result = in testConcatWithSuggestionSpansOnly() 65 (Spanned)SpannableStringUtils.concatWithNonParagraphSuggestionSpansOnly(a, b); in testConcatWithSuggestionSpansOnly() 71 flags & Spanned.SPAN_PARAGRAPH, 0); in testConcatWithSuggestionSpansOnly() 78 if (cs instanceof Spanned) { in assertSpanCount() 79 final Spanned spanned = (Spanned) cs; in assertSpanCount() 89 assertTrue(cs instanceof Spanned); in assertSpan() 90 final Spanned spanned = (Spanned) cs; in assertSpan() [all …]
|
/packages/inputmethods/LatinIME/java/src/com/android/inputmethod/latin/utils/ |
D | SpannableStringUtils.java | 21 import android.text.Spanned; 49 public static void copyNonParagraphSuggestionSpansFrom(Spanned source, int start, int end, in copyNonParagraphSuggestionSpansFrom() 60 fl &= ~Spanned.SPAN_PARAGRAPH; in copyNonParagraphSuggestionSpansFrom() 93 if (text[i] instanceof Spanned) { in concatWithNonParagraphSuggestionSpansOnly() 113 if (text[i] instanceof Spanned) { in concatWithNonParagraphSuggestionSpansOnly() 114 copyNonParagraphSuggestionSpansFrom((Spanned) text[i], 0, len, ss, off); in concatWithNonParagraphSuggestionSpansOnly() 125 if (!(text instanceof Spanned)) { in hasUrlSpans() 128 final Spanned spanned = (Spanned)text; in hasUrlSpans() 153 if (!(charSequence instanceof Spanned)) { in split()
|
D | TextRange.java | 19 import android.text.Spanned; 54 if (!(mTextAtCursor instanceof Spanned && mWord instanceof Spanned)) { in getSuggestionSpansAtWord() 57 final Spanned text = (Spanned)mTextAtCursor; in getSuggestionSpansAtWord()
|
/packages/inputmethods/LatinIME/java/src/com/android/inputmethod/compat/ |
D | LocaleSpanCompatUtils.java | 20 import android.text.Spanned; 131 isStartExclusive = ((spanFlag & Spanned.SPAN_EXCLUSIVE_EXCLUSIVE) == in updateLocaleSpan() 132 Spanned.SPAN_EXCLUSIVE_EXCLUSIVE); in updateLocaleSpan() 136 isEndExclusive = ((spanFlag & Spanned.SPAN_EXCLUSIVE_EXCLUSIVE) == in updateLocaleSpan() 137 Spanned.SPAN_EXCLUSIVE_EXCLUSIVE); in updateLocaleSpan() 205 return (originalFlag & ~Spanned.SPAN_POINT_MARK_MASK) | in getSpanFlag() 212 return isEndExclusive ? Spanned.SPAN_EXCLUSIVE_EXCLUSIVE in getSpanPointMarkFlag() 213 : Spanned.SPAN_EXCLUSIVE_INCLUSIVE; in getSpanPointMarkFlag() 215 return isEndExclusive ? Spanned.SPAN_INCLUSIVE_EXCLUSIVE in getSpanPointMarkFlag() 216 : Spanned.SPAN_INCLUSIVE_INCLUSIVE; in getSpanPointMarkFlag()
|
D | SuggestionSpanUtils.java | 22 import android.text.Spanned; 69 Spanned.SPAN_EXCLUSIVE_EXCLUSIVE | Spanned.SPAN_COMPOSING); in getTextWithAutoCorrectionIndicatorUnderline() 98 spannable.setSpan(suggestionSpan, 0, pickedWord.length(), Spanned.SPAN_EXCLUSIVE_EXCLUSIVE); in getTextWithSuggestionSpan()
|
/packages/apps/Contacts/tests/src/com/android/contacts/format/ |
D | SpannedTestUtils.java | 21 import android.text.Spanned; 39 String actualHtmlText = Html.toHtml((Spanned) textView.getText()); in checkHtmlText() 57 Assert.assertTrue(seq instanceof Spanned); in assertPrefixSpan() 58 Spanned spannable = (Spanned) seq; in assertPrefixSpan() 68 private static int getNumForegroundColorSpansBetween(Spanned value, int start, int end) { in getNumForegroundColorSpansBetween() 79 Assert.assertFalse(seq instanceof Spanned); in assertNotSpanned()
|
/packages/apps/ManagedProvisioning/src/com/android/managedprovisioning/common/ |
D | AccessibilityContextMenuMaker.java | 23 import android.text.Spanned; 91 Spanned spanned = getText(textView); in populateMenuContent() 117 private @Nullable Spanned getText(TextView textView) { in getText() 119 return (text instanceof Spanned) ? (Spanned) text : null; in getText() 122 private @NonNull ClickableSpan[] getSpans(Spanned spanned) { in getSpans()
|
D | HtmlToSpannedParser.java | 18 import static android.text.Spanned.SPAN_EXCLUSIVE_EXCLUSIVE; 26 import android.text.Spanned; 56 public Spanned parseHtml(String htmlContent) { in parseHtml() 57 Spanned spanned = Html.fromHtml(checkStringNotEmpty(htmlContent), HTML_MODE); in parseHtml()
|
/packages/apps/Dialer/java/com/android/dialer/spannable/ |
D | ContentWithLearnMoreSpanner.java | 21 import android.text.Spanned; 84 Spanned.SPAN_INCLUSIVE_INCLUSIVE); in create() 90 Spanned.SPAN_INCLUSIVE_INCLUSIVE); in create()
|
/packages/apps/Dialer/java/com/android/dialer/voicemail/listui/error/ |
D | VoicemailTosMessageCreator.java | 31 import android.text.Spanned; 498 Spanned.SPAN_EXCLUSIVE_EXCLUSIVE); 511 Spanned.SPAN_EXCLUSIVE_EXCLUSIVE); 529 Spanned.SPAN_EXCLUSIVE_EXCLUSIVE); 544 spannable.setSpan(new URLSpan(linkUrl), start, end, Spanned.SPAN_EXCLUSIVE_EXCLUSIVE); 549 Spanned.SPAN_EXCLUSIVE_EXCLUSIVE);
|
/packages/apps/Dialer/java/com/android/dialer/searchfragment/common/ |
D | QueryBoldingUtil.java | 24 import android.text.Spanned; 109 Spanned.SPAN_INCLUSIVE_INCLUSIVE); in getNameWithInitialsBolded() 164 new StyleSpan(Typeface.BOLD), index, index + numBolded, Spanned.SPAN_INCLUSIVE_EXCLUSIVE); in getBoldedString()
|
/packages/apps/Dialer/java/com/android/dialer/dialpadview/ |
D | UnicodeDialerKeyListener.java | 20 import android.text.Spanned; 34 CharSequence source, int start, int end, Spanned dest, int dstart, int dend) { in filter()
|
/packages/apps/PermissionController/src/com/android/packageinstaller/permission/ui/ |
D | GrantPermissionsWatchViewHandler.java | 15 import android.text.Spanned; 118 Spanned.SPAN_EXCLUSIVE_EXCLUSIVE); in showDialog() 123 Spanned.SPAN_EXCLUSIVE_EXCLUSIVE); in showDialog()
|
/packages/apps/QuickSearchBox/tests/src/com/android/quicksearchbox/ |
D | LevenshteinFormatterTest.java | 24 import android.text.Spanned; 152 Spanned s = mFormatter.formatSuggestion(query, suggestion); in verifyFormatSuggestion() 350 public void verify(Spanned spanned) { in verify()
|
/packages/apps/Car/Settings/src/com/android/car/settings/bluetooth/ |
D | Utf8ByteLengthFilter.java | 20 import android.text.Spanned; 50 Spanned dest, int dstart, int dend) { in filter()
|
/packages/apps/Settings/src/com/android/settings/bluetooth/ |
D | Utf8ByteLengthFilter.java | 20 import android.text.Spanned; 51 Spanned dest, int dstart, int dend) { in filter()
|
/packages/services/Car/tests/CarDeveloperOptions/src/com/android/car/developeroptions/bluetooth/ |
D | Utf8ByteLengthFilter.java | 20 import android.text.Spanned; 51 Spanned dest, int dstart, int dend) { in filter()
|
/packages/apps/ManagedProvisioning/src/com/android/managedprovisioning/preprovisioning/terms/adapters/ |
D | TermsAdapterUtils.java | 20 import android.text.Spanned; 47 Spanned content = htmlToSpannedParser.parseHtml(disclaimer.getContent()); in populateContentTextView()
|
/packages/apps/ManagedProvisioning/tests/instrumentation/src/com/android/managedprovisioning/common/ |
D | HtmlToSpannedParserTest.java | 22 import android.text.Spanned; 71 Spanned spanned = mHtmlToSpannedParser.parseHtml(inputHtml); in assertRawTextCorrect()
|
/packages/apps/Car/CompanionDeviceSupport/src/com/android/car/companiondevicesupport/activity/ |
D | AddAssociatedDeviceFragment.java | 26 import android.text.Spanned; 70 Spanned styledSelectText = Html.fromHtml(selectText, Html.FROM_HTML_MODE_LEGACY); in setDeviceNameForAssociation()
|
/packages/apps/TV/src/com/android/tv/guide/ |
D | ProgramItemView.java | 29 import android.text.Spanned; 374 description.setSpan(titleStyle, 0, middle, Spanned.SPAN_EXCLUSIVE_EXCLUSIVE); in updateText() 376 episodeStyle, middle, description.length(), Spanned.SPAN_EXCLUSIVE_EXCLUSIVE); in updateText() 379 titleStyle, 0, description.length(), Spanned.SPAN_EXCLUSIVE_EXCLUSIVE); in updateText()
|
/packages/apps/QuickSearchBox/src/com/android/quicksearchbox/ |
D | LevenshteinSuggestionFormatter.java | 24 import android.text.Spanned; 40 public Spanned formatSuggestion(String query, String suggestion) { in formatSuggestion()
|